Brainerd board asks for more study before deciding on withdrawal from Paul Bunyan Education Cooperative Board members discussed whether Brainerd should manage federal special-education funds directly instead of routing them through the Paul Bunyan Education Cooperative; trustees asked for additional financial analysis, an audit of services, and follow-up presentations before any decision.

Finance committee reviews IU services, contracts and budget outlook; charter tuition pressure highlighted The Finance Committee received a Bucks County Intermediate Unit presentation showing Pennridge's 2026-27 programs-and-services contribution at $82,580. Administrators reviewed contracts (Microsoft renewal, GASB 75 valuation, Rubrik backup) and described fiscal 2024-25 variances driven by IU services, substitutes and cyber charter tuition, which added pressure to the general fund.

Finance committee reviews Ricoh copier refresh, contracts and warns of budget pressure from lower state aid and assessed‑value growth Finance staff proposed a December copier fleet refresh under a discounted CoStars pricing arrangement to replace end‑of‑life print management software; the committee also reviewed several student‑placement and service contracts and received an overview of the Act 1 index and state funding uncertainty, including roughly $9.8 million in year‑to‑date,
